Over the last six months Debian has been the fastest growing Linux distribution when measured by counting active sites which contain the name of a
Linux distribution in the Apache Server header. In percentage terms Debian is closely followed by SuSE and Gentoo. RedHat has a far greater number of
sites but a slower growth rate, and actually fell this month, after making widely publicized and controversial changes to its licencing and security
update policy. A distribution name is present in a little over a quarter of Linux based Apache sites.
